The Consequences of Mixing Incompatible Greases
Ultimately, the success of a lubrication management program rests on the team's ability to lubricate bearings with the proper grease at the right time and in the right amount.
Grease is gravely important to understand. If you add a different grease than what was originally used, especially if it is incompatible, this can create massive issues within the machine. Once greases are mixed, they can't be undone, which can mean unplanned downtime and costly repairs or bearing replacements.
But what exactly happens when two incompatible greases are mixed?
To start, mixing incompatible greases can cause severe damage to bearings. Take a thickener and a base oil, for example. The thickener holds the grease in place, and the base oil lubricates the components. However, if you were to mix two incompatible thickeners, the base oil would bleed out excessively, leading to a catastrophic bearing failure due to starvation.
